Fidelity Service Group Looking for the administrative experience Intern for the year 2026 in Cape Town, Western Cape

About the Programme

The Administrative Assistant Internship Programme is designed to equip young professionals with practical administrative experience, preparing them for future careers in office management, customer service, and general business administration. This internship is fully workplace-based with mentorship support to ensure your growth and learning throughout the programme.

Programme Highlights

FieldDetails
ProgrammeAdministrative Assistant Internship Programme 2026
CompanyFidelity Services Group
LocationCape Town, Western Cape
Duration2 years
CompensationStipend-based
Minimum QualificationMatric or college qualification
Closing Date31 March 2026
Experience RequiredNone (entry-level)
Opportunity TypeWorkplace internship with mentorship and exposure

 Key Responsibilities

Interns in this programme will have exposure to a variety of administrative and office management tasks, including:

General Administration Support

You may assist with:

  • capturing information
  • filing documents
  • maintaining records
  • organising office files
  • updating spreadsheets

These tasks develop accuracy and attention to detail — two highly valued workplace skills.

Communication Support

Interns help coordinate communication by:

  • answering phone calls
  • responding to emails
  • routing internal requests
  • assisting teams with coordination tasks

Communication skills are critical for any administration career path.

Departmental Assistance

Interns may support different business units depending on operational needs.

Exposure could include:

  • finance admin support
  • HR documentation
  • logistics coordination
  • reporting assistance
  • scheduling support

This cross-department exposure helps interns understand how organisations function.

Event Coordination Support

Some interns assist with:

  • internal meetings
  • training sessions
  • company workshops
  • operational events

These tasks strengthen organisational and planning skills.

Research and Reporting Tasks

You may help prepare:

  • summaries
  • spreadsheets
  • tracking reports
  • internal documents

These responsibilities improve workplace confidence and analytical thinking.

Eligibility Criteria

To qualify, applicants must meet the following criteria:

Education

Applicants must have:

  • Matric certificate
    OR
  • College qualification

This makes the programme accessible to both school-leavers and TVET graduates.

Skills Required

Successful candidates should demonstrate:

  • strong verbal communication skills
  • basic written communication ability
  • Microsoft Office knowledge
  • organisational ability
  • attention to detail
  • ability to work independently
  • ability to work in a team

These are core entry-level administration competencies.

Who Should Apply for This Internship

This opportunity is ideal for:

  • matriculants seeking office experience
  • TVET graduates in administration-related programmes
  • unemployed youth starting careers
  • candidates interested in HR support roles
  • candidates interested in receptionist careers
  • aspiring data capturers
  • future office administrators

It is especially suitable if you want to transition into:

  • government administration clerk roles
  • municipal office support jobs
  • corporate admin assistant positions

Required Documents You will Asked to Upload

Applicants should prepare:

  • Updated CV
  • Certified copy of ID
  • Certified Matric certificate
  • College qualification (if available)
  • Short motivation letter

Your motivation letter should explain:

  • why you want admin experience
  • what skills you bring
  • how the internship supports your career goals
